Output 98f6226958dab514b03b816cec841914ea7d014e4d2d2b38c84a18bbedd6e8ae:1

value
14116397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b0e9cafb63cf1f5234a49e8f993aedd5f9cfa5b OP_EQUAL
address
38Xt7CEY3B93NRwaj5yH9q67fg6NyFHX1u
transaction
98f6226958dab514b03b816cec841914ea7d014e4d2d2b38c84a18bbedd6e8ae
spent
true